Imothy, unto whom this Epiftle was writ, was an Ephef. 4.1 Evangelift, that is, inferior to Apostles and extraordinary Prophets, and above ordinary Pastors and Teachers. And he with the rest of thofe under his circumstances was to go with the Apoules

B. S

Apostles hither, and thither, to be difpofed of by them as they faw need for the further edification of those who by the Apoftolical Ministry were converted to the Faith:

And

1 was hence it is that Titus was left at Tim.1.3. Creet, and that this Timothy was left at Ephefus. For they were to do a work for Chrift in the world, which the Apostles were to begin, and leave upon their hand to finish. Now when the Apostles departed from places, and had left thefe Evangelists in their stead, ufually there did arile foine badSpirits among thofe people, where these were left for the furtherance of the Faith. This is manifeft by both the Epistles to Timothy, and alfo by that to Titus: wherefore Paul, upon whom thefe two Evangelifts waited for the fulfilling of their Ministry, writeth unto them while they abode where he left them, concerning those turbulent Sprits which they met with, and to teach them how yet further they ought to behave themfelves in the houfe of God, which is the Church of the living God, the pillar and ground of truth... And to this pur pofe

[ocr errors]

pofe he gives them severally divers inftructions (as the judicious Reader may easily understand) by which he incourageth them to the profecution of that fervice which for Chrift they had to do for those people where he had left them, and alfo inftructeth them how to carry it towards their disturbers, which laft he doth, not only Doctrinally, but alfo by thew ing them by his example and practice, what he would have them do...

This done,he laboureth to comfort Timothy with the remembrance of the ftedfastnefs of Gods eternal de. cree of Election, because grounded on his foreknowledge; faying, tho Hymeneus and Philetus have erred from the Faith, and by their fall, have overthrown the Faith of fome, Tec·· the foundation of God ftandeth fure, having this Seal, the Lord knoweth them that are his Now left this lait hint fhould ftill incourage fome to be remifs and carnally fecure, and foolish, as I fuppofe this Doctrine abufed, had incouraged them to be before: Therefore the Apostle immediately conjoyneth to it, this exhortation: And, let every one that
